I am just saying TB and plenum, especially accufab, is really expensive. Do not get me wrong the accufab stuff is freaking beautiful. I would agree a TB and plenum is going to give you some hp gains. But it can also give you idle, throttle cable, and idle drop issues.

But I think the overall driving experience of the car would be much better enhanced by a nice set of bilsteins instead of the accufab stuff...

On a 2000 GT your shocks and struts are gone man. A new set will totally renew your Mustang's feel.

this may shock some of you,.. but I actually agree with Killy for once

the TB and Plenum isnt gonna do alot on a car without other supporting mods, and for the money it just isn't very cost efficient.

the things he listed are the way to go.. get the grill delete and chin spoiler(even though I usually dont spend money on my car unless it increases 1/4 mile traps )

MGW, I like my tri-ax but others love the MGW so thats a personal preference thing

and Shocks and struts are a MUST!

for the money Strange makes an excellent shock/strut that will perform great street or strip because of the adjusments.
